8核8内存的云服务器装windows系统很卡?

云计算

8核8GB内存的云服务器在理论上是具备一定性能的配置,但如果安装 Windows 系统后感觉“很卡”,这是比较常见的情况,尤其在云服务器环境下。以下是可能的原因和优化建议:


一、可能原因分析

1. Windows 系统本身资源占用高

  • 相比 Linux,Windows 操作系统(尤其是 Windows Server 或桌面版)本身启动后就占用较多内存和 CPU。
  • 例如:
    • Windows Server 2019/2022 默认启动后可能占用 2~4GB 内存
    • 后台服务(如更新、安全中心、遥测等)持续运行,消耗资源。

2. 8GB 内存对 Windows 来说偏小

  • 如果你运行的是 Windows Server + IIS + SQL Server 或其他应用,8GB 内存很容易被占满。
  • 一旦内存不足,系统会频繁使用虚拟内存(页面文件),而云盘 I/O 性能有限,导致“卡顿”。

3. 云服务器磁盘性能不足

  • 有些云服务器默认使用 普通云硬盘(HDD 或低性能 SSD),I/O 性能较差。
  • Windows 系统频繁读写页面文件、更新、日志等,对磁盘压力大,低 IOPS 会导致卡顿。

4. 未安装或未优化云厂商的增强驱动(如 VirtIO)

  • 没有安装 云服务商提供的驱动(如阿里云的 PV Driver、腾讯云的 Guest OS Driver),会导致网卡、磁盘性能无法发挥,表现为延迟高、响应慢。

5. 远程桌面(RDP)体验问题

  • 卡顿感可能来自 RDP 远程连接本身,尤其是网络延迟高、带宽低、图形复杂时。
  • 并非服务器卡,而是显示渲染慢。

6. 后台自动更新或杀毒软件占用资源

  • Windows 自动更新下载、安装补丁时会占用大量 CPU 和带宽。
  • 安装了第三方杀毒软件(如 360、腾讯电脑管家)会严重拖慢性能。

7. 虚拟化环境资源争抢(共享型实例)

  • 如果你使用的是 共享型实例(如 t5、t6 实例),CPU 性能受“积分”限制,高峰时段性能下降明显。

二、优化建议

✅ 1. 选择轻量级 Windows 版本

  • 使用 Windows Server Core(无 GUI)或 Server Nano(更轻),减少资源占用。
  • 避免使用 Windows 10/11 桌面版作为服务器系统。

✅ 2. 关闭不必要的服务和视觉效果

  • 禁用:
    • Windows Update(或设为手动)
    • Superfetch / SysMain
    • Windows Search
    • 错误报告、遥测等
  • 关闭视觉效果:
    • 右键“此电脑” → 高级系统设置 → 性能 → 调整为“最佳性能”

✅ 3. 安装云厂商提供的增强驱动

  • 阿里云:安装 PV Driver
  • 腾讯云:安装 Guest OS Driver
  • 华为云、AWS、Azure 等也有类似工具
  • 可显著提升磁盘和网络性能

✅ 4. 升级磁盘为高性能 SSD

  • 将系统盘更换为 高性能 SSD 或 ESSD,提高 IOPS。
  • 建议系统盘至少 100GB 以上,避免空间不足影响性能。

✅ 5. 增加内存或升级配置

  • 若运行数据库、IIS、.NET 应用等,建议升级到 16GB 内存
  • 8GB 对 Windows 多任务运行偏紧张。

✅ 6. 使用专业版/企业版,避免或非优化镜像

  • 使用云厂商官方提供的 Windows 镜像,避免使用第三方“精简版”或“优化版”系统,可能存在兼容性问题。

✅ 7. 优化远程桌面体验

  • RDP 连接时:
    • 降低颜色质量(16位)
    • 关闭桌面背景、动画、字体平滑
    • 使用局域网或高质量网络连接

✅ 8. 避免使用共享型实例

  • 改用 通用型或计算型独享实例(如阿里云 g7、c7,腾讯云 S5 等),确保 CPU 性能稳定。

三、替代方案建议

如果只是用于部署 Web 服务、数据库等,建议:

  • 改用 Linux 系统(如 CentOS、Ubuntu),资源占用低,性能更好。
  • 使用 Nginx + .NET Core(跨平台)或 WSL 运行 Windows 兼容应用。

总结

8核8G 跑 Windows 卡,核心原因:Windows 本身吃资源 + 磁盘性能不足 + 优化不到位。

🔧 建议操作顺序:

  1. 确认是否为共享型实例 → 升级为独享型
  2. 安装云厂商增强驱动
  3. 关闭无用服务和视觉效果
  4. 升级系统盘为高性能 SSD
  5. 考虑升级内存至 16GB 或改用 Linux

如果你提供具体用途(如跑 IIS、SQL、远程桌面等),我可以给出更针对性的优化建议。